Trump Initiates Legal Battle Against Truth Social Co-Founders Over Mismanagement Allegations

Former U.S. President Donald Trump has taken legal action against two co-founders of Trump Media, alleging mismanagement of Truth Social, his social media platform.

In response, the co-founders, Wes Moss and Andy Litinsky, had previously filed a lawsuit against Trump in February to protect their stake in the company.

This legal dispute stems from the aftermath of the Capitol riot in January, when Trump was banned from major social media platforms. Moss and Litinsky proposed Truth Social as an alternative.

In a recent lawsuit filed on March 24th in a Florida state court, Trump’s legal team accused Moss and Litinsky of failing in their duties, causing harm to Trump Media & Technology Group (TMTG), Truth Social’s parent company. The lawsuit claims that their decisions led to a decline in TMTG’s stock price and slowed down the company’s public listing process.

The conflict escalates as Trump’s lawyers seek to cancel Moss and Litinsky’s shares, valued at around $600 million. Trump established TMTG in 2021 in response to being banned from major social media platforms after the Capitol riot.

The legal battle unfolds amid Truth Social’s recent merger with a special purpose acquisition company (SPAC). Despite initial enthusiasm in the market, the company now faces regulatory scrutiny and other challenges, causing a decline in its stock value.

Neither Wes Moss nor Andy Litinsky were immediately available for comment on Trump’s legal action against them.
